One was like. But first this morning an image | :00:20. | :00:22. | |
charity's urging people to sign a petition to force the makers of | :00:23. | :00:26. | |
Moshi Monster to change the names of its evil characters. A group called | :00:27. | :00:29. | |
Changing Faces says names like Fishlips and Freakface reinforce | :00:30. | :00:31. | |
negative views of people with facial disfigurements like scars, spots or | :00:32. | :00:35. | |
bad eyes. The charity say the fact Moshi monster's baddies have these | :00:36. | :00:37. | |
traits makes people associated disfigurement with being bad and | :00:38. | :00:40. | |
could encourage bullying. Moshi's makers say they're speaking to the | :00:41. | :00:43. | |
charity and apologise for any offence caused. Last summer Changing | :00:44. | :00:45. | |
Faces made a similar complaint about Lego. | :00:46. | :01:01. | |
Next up, if you've ever wondered what life was like as a soldier | :01:02. | :01:05. | |
during World War One then you'll be able to find out from today. | :01:06. | :01:08. | |
Millions of pages of diary entries, describing life on the front line | :01:09. | :01:11. | |
are being made available online. The National Archives is releasing them | :01:12. | :01:15. | |
as part of events to mark a hundred years since the First World War | :01:16. | :01:17. | |

guy. He tried to change my mind. Finally to the incredible journey of | :04:31. | :04:33. | |
a seal who wound up in a farmer's field, 50 miles from the sea. Search | :04:34. | :04:37. | |
and rescue teams tracked the pup down in a field in Appleby, Cumbria. | :04:38. | :04:41. | |
They believe the seal must have swum inland by mistake. After a bit of a | :04:42. | :04:45. | |
struggle to get the creature into a special container he was eventually | :04:46. | :04:48. | |
released at a spot popular with seal colonies. | :04:49. | :04:55. | |
